16 / 22 page ![]() Programming STM8 Flash microcontrollers PM0212 16/22 Doc ID 022351 Rev 2 The erase/program cycle lasts longer if the whole word containing the byte to be programmed is not empty because in this case an erase operation is performed automatically. If the word is empty, the erase operation is not performed. However, if a defined programming time is wanted, the FIX bit in the FLASH_CR1 register forces the programming operation to always erase first whatever the contents of the memory. Therefore a fixed programming time is guaranteed (erase time + write time). To erase a byte location, just write ‘0x00’ to the byte location. Caution: A byte programming operation performs a word (4-byte) access to the Flash program memory. If a byte program operation is interrupted by a reset, the 4 bytes programmed in the memory may be corrupted. 4.5 Programming the option bytes Option bytes are used to configure the device hardware features as well as the memory protection. They are stored in a dedicated memory block. 4.5.1 Summary of memory dedicated option bytes The Flash program memory includes several option bytes dedicated to memory protection: ● ROP The ROP option byte is used to prevent the Flash program memory from being read and modified in ICP/SWIM mode. Refer to Section 3.1: Readout protection for a detailed description of readout protection. ● PCODESIZE The PCODESIZE option byte is used to configure the size of the proprietary code area (PCODE) which can be used to store proprietary software libraries. The minimum size of the proprietary code area is of 1 page (64 bytes) and the maximum size of 253 pages. The PCODESIZE option byte can be modified only in ICP/SWIM mode. Refer to Section 3.2: Proprietary code area protection for a detailed description of the PCODE area and PCODESIZE option byte. ● UBC The UBC option byte is used to program the size of the write protected user boot code area. The boot area always includes the reset and interrupt vectors and can go up to the full program memory size. The boot area size granularity is of one page. Refer to Section 3.3: User Boot Code area protection for a detailed description of the UBC area. ● DATASIZE The DATASIZE option byte is used to configure the size of the data EEPROM area. This option byte specifies the number of pages starting from the end of the memory. The maximum size of the data EEPROM area is of 2 Kbytes. Refer to STM8TL5xxx datasheet for details on DATASIZE value programming. |
